  • CBD Is Analgesic

The painkilling properties of CBD are among its most recognizable uses. According to the U.S. National Library of Medicine, CBD stops anandamide absorption, a chemical in the brain responsible for signaling pain. It literally disrupts pain perception, making it highly effective. This temporary anandamide surge might have several different effects, with lower sensation to pain just one of them.

What is more, the anti-inflammatory properties of CBD also work to relieve pain. By treating any underlying inflammation, such as arthritis, as example, this cannabinoid actively treats pain at its source. Unlike conventional analgesics for pets, CBD has no scary or dangerous side effects. It does not dull the senses, tranquilize, or cause any of the myriad issues so common with painkiller medications.

  • CBD Is Anti-Inflammatory

 

The anti-inflammatory effect of CBD is fast becoming mainstream knowledge. It is famous for effectively reducing inflammation, a potential reason for its success in treating such a wide variety of diseases. According to the U.S. National Library of Medicine, this is likely due to its interaction with endocannabinoid receptors within immune cells themselves.

Specifically, it activates CB2 receptors, triggering myriad immune responses, one of which is fighting inflammation. This is especially helpful for pets suffering bowel diseases, arthritis, and other conditions characterized by chronic inflammation. Often this inflammation is directly the result of an immune system malfunction, putting healthy cells at risk. By treating inflammation, CBD proves very effective.

  • CBD Is Antiemetic

 

Vomiting and nausea are common symptoms of many diseases in pets. They are often a side effect of some medications and treatments too, such as chemotherapy, for example. These symptoms are serious on their own, causing appetite issues, weight loss, fatigue, dehydration, and more. The market offers plenty of antiemetic drugs and for pets, acepromazine and chlorpromazine are common examples.

These drugs have debilitating side effects. They knock your pets out, cause hypertension, drooling, and other alarming issues. Fortunately, CBD can help. It is a safe antiemetic for animals, strong enough to control both vomiting and nausea, all while stimulating appetite in the process. In fact, the U.S. National Library of Medicine touts CBD safer and more effective than available drugs.
